一尘不染

如何在作业开始之前清除Jenkins管道中的工作区

jenkins

我需要在构建开始之前清除工作空间。我尝试cleanDir()分阶段使用,但在声明性管道中,检出首先发生,而在cleadDir运行阶段时,检出的代码也会被清除,这是不希望的。在声明式管道中签出之前,我们如何清除工作空间?


阅读 286

收藏
2020-07-25

共1个答案

一尘不染

在Git运行时使用VCS的方法

git clean -fdx
2020-07-25